by Davin Swanson
From the supps:

7.6 NUMBER OF EVENTS SCORED
A competitor shall compete in at least one half (1/2) of all Championship events held in the season to be eligible for yearend awards. A competitor will drop their lowest event scores at the rate shown in Appendix D. Any event for which an entrant qualifies for an average shall be considered an attended event.

APPENDIX D - CSCC Solo Number of Drops Index

Code: Select all

Number of Events     Number of Drops
1 to 3                    0
4 to 6                    1
7 to 10                   2
11 to 13                  3 
14 to 16                  4 
17 and up                 5
So actually, nobody's at zero yet. :mrgreen: If you're interested in computing points on your own, the formula is:

100 - 400 * ( (driver's time - winner's time) / (winner's time) )

Ed Holley wrote: And, of course, it had to be Davin who would respond (inside joke). So, oh wise one, the PURPOSE of "drops" is/are?
It just gives people the possibility of competing for a championship even if they have to miss a few events throughout the year. You drop your <see chart above> lowest scores.

Ed Holley wrote:
Jeff Stuart wrote:
Ed Holley wrote: And, of course, it had to be Davin who would respond (inside joke). So, oh wise one, the PURPOSE of "drops" is/are?
It just gives people the possibility of competing for a championship even if they have to miss a few events throughout the year. You drop your <see chart above> lowest scores.
So...if I'm understanding correctly...let's say there are 14 events and I run 10 of them. I will have to "drop" 2 of my 10 events run. Is this correct? And let's say my closest competitor has run only 6 events. He would have to "drop" 1 of HIS or HER events. Is this also correct?
No, your lowest scores are the 4 zeros for the 4 missed events. Look at it the other way. You are scored on your best 10 if we run 14 events.
